Conservation Reserve Program Update

As of December 31, 2000, South Carolina had 218,109 acres enrolled in the Conservation Reserve Program.

Although no general CRP signup is scheduled for fiscal year 2001, producers with contracts expiring September 30, 2001, have been afforded an opportunity to extend their CRP contracts for one year.  Producers with CRP contracts expiring on September 30, 2001, must request to extend their contracts for one year by May 31, 2001.  In South Carolina approximately 4,000 acres under contract will expire on September 30, 2001.

The 23rd Continuous CRP signup began October 1, 2000 and will end on September 30, 2001.  As of December 31, 2000, South Carolina had 268.5 acres enrolled under the 23rd Continuous CRP signup.
